Nearly 39,000 human papillomavirus (HPV)-associated cancers were
diagnosed annually from 2008 through 2012, up from 33,369 cases seen
from 2004 to 2008, according to CDC. For the study, CDC used data from population-based cancer registries
that participate in its National Program of Cancer Registries and the
National Cancer Institute's Surveillance, Epidemiology, and End Results
program. CDC found that approximately 23,000 of the HPV-associated cases
were among females.
